CITY OF NORTH OLMSTED <br />ORDINANCE N0. 87-96 <br />BY: RONALD WILAMOSKY <br />AN ORDINANCE ESTABLISHING POLICY REGARDING THE <br />ACCUMULATION OF VACATION LEAVE FOR ALL DEPARTMENTS <br />WITHIN THE CITY OF NORTH OLMSTED. <br />WHEREAS, this Council has been advised that Section 2 of Ordinance No. <br />83-31 has in the past permitted employees to be paid for accumulated <br />vacation time; and <br />WHEREAS, it is the opinion of this Council that vacation time is set <br />aside for the benefit of employees and that it is not a sound management <br />practice to permit employees to be paid for vacation time instead of taking <br />the time permitted by the ordinances of the City of North Olmsted; and <br />WHEREAS, it is the opinion of this Council that a policy should be <br />established whereby employees may accumulate vacation time from one year to <br />the next and not be paid for vacation time in lieu of time off. <br />N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T ORDAINED BY THE CO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F NORTH <br />OLMSTED, COUNTY OF CUYAHOGA AND STATE OF OHIO: <br />SECTION 1: That this Council does hereby establish the following <br />vacation policy: <br />Employees shall be permitted to request that vacation leave credit, <br />earned in the prior year, be accumulated. In no event, shall the employee <br />be permitted to accumulate vacation leave credit in excess of the vacation <br />leave credit earned in the prior year. Employees shall be required to take <br />accumulated vacation leave credit within one (1) year from the date <br />employee requested accumulation of such vacation leave credit. Employee <br />shall forfeit his right to take or to be paid for any vacation leave to his <br />credit which is in excess of the accumulated vacation credit for one (1) <br />prior year, All such excess vacation leave credit shall be eliminated from <br />the employee's vacation leave balance. <br />SECTION 2: That any ordinance or parts of ordinances inconsistent <br />herewith are hereby repealed. <br />SECTION 3: That this Ordinance shall take effect and be in force from <br />and after the earliest period allowed by law. <br />PASSED : 2o~lp ~~ <br />ATTEST: <br />ORENCE E.
